answersLogoWhite

0


Best Answer

Sol: Boundary tags are data structures on the boundary between blocks in the heap from which memory is allocated. The use of such tags allow blocks of arbitrary size to be used as shown in the Fig. 2.1.

FREE

USED

FREE

Fig. 2.1

Suppose 'n ' bytes of memory are to be allocated from a large area, in contiguous blocks of varying size, and that no form of compaction or rearrangement of the allocated segments will be used.

To reserve a block of 'n ' bytes of memory, a free space of size 'n' or larger must be located. If we could locate a large size memory, then the allocation process will divide it into an allocated space, and a new smaller free space. Suppose free space is subdivided in this manner several times, and some of the allocated regions are "released" (after usei. e . , deallocated).

If we try to reserve more memory; even though there is a large contiguous chunk of free space, the memory manager perceives it as two smaller segments and so may falsely conclude that it has insufficient free space to satisfy a large request.

For optimal use of the memory, adjacent free segments must be combined. For maximum availability, they must be combined as soon as possible. The task of identifying and merging adjacent free segments should be done when a segment is released, called the boundary tag method. The method consistently applied to ensure that there would never be two adjacent free segments. This guarantees the largest available free space short of compacting the string space.

User Avatar

Wiki User

9y ago
This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: What is boundary tag method?
Write your answer...
Submit
Still have questions?
magnify glass
imp
Related questions

Can you tag a player with a ball in dodgeball?

From research there is no rule stating that you can't tag a player with a ball and they will be out. Although... there is a rule stating if you cross your boundary lines you are out. If you can tag a player without crossing the line they should be out.


Do polyhedron and cones have one base?

It depends on which method of tag you are playing


What is the main method of starting PHP code?

When scripting in PHP, you always want to open up the script with a tag.


What has the author W S Hall written?

W. S. Hall has written: 'The boundary element method' -- subject(s): Boundary element methods


What is the difference between finite element method and Ritz method?

The main difference between the Rayleigh-Ritz method (RRM) and the finite element method lies in the definition of the basis functions. For FEM, these are element-related functions, whereas for RRM these are valid for the whole domain and have to fit the boundary conditions. The Rayleigh-Ritz method for homogeneous boundary conditions leads to the same discretized equations as the Galerkin method of weighted residuals.


Is it possible to employ Finite Element Method to open-boundary modelling?

please help


What is the difference between interior optimum and boundary optimum?

The interior optimum method uses an a choice that is determined by the position of an agent at a tangency that rests between the curves of two points on a graph. The boundary optimum method analyzes the position of waves.


What method do you use to expose JSTL tag information so it can collaborate with its environment?

explicit


How can the mark and recapture method help ecologists monitor the size of a population?

by mark tag it


What has the author A Elzein written?

A. Elzein has written: 'Plate stability by boundary element method' -- subject(s): Boundary element methods, Plates (Engineering), Structural stability


What has the author A A Bakr written?

A. A. Bakr has written: 'The boundary integral equation method in axisymmetric stress analysis problems' -- subject(s): Boundary element methods, Strains and stresses


What has the author V M Babich written?

V. M. Babich has written: 'The boundary-layer method in diffraction problems' -- subject(s): Diffraction, Boundary value problems